30.—(1) The notice of opposition shall contain a statement of the grounds upon which the opponent opposes the registration.
(2) If registration is opposed on the ground that the mark is identical or similar to an earlier trade mark, the following information must be included in the statement, for the purpose of determining whether the mark is identical or similar to the earlier trade mark:
(a)
a representation of the earlier trade mark; and
(b)
such of the following as may be applicable:
(i)
if the earlier trade mark is registered —
(A)
its registration number; and
(B)
the class number and specification of the goods or services in respect of which the earlier trade mark is registered;
(ii)
if the application to register the earlier trade mark is pending —
(A)
the number accorded by the Registrar to the application; and
(B)
the class number and specification of the goods or services in respect of which the earlier trade mark is sought to be registered; or
(iii)
if the earlier trade mark is not registered, and no application has been made to register it, the specification of the goods or services in respect of which the earlier trade mark is used.

(3) If registration is opposed on the ground that the mark is identical or similar to an earlier trade mark which is well known in Singapore, the following additional information must be included in the statement for the purpose of determining whether the trade mark is well known in Singapore:
(a)
information on the use of the earlier trade mark; and
(b)
information on any promotion undertaken for the earlier trade mark.
